POWER SUPPLY

BATTERY OPERATION

NOTE:

AC OPERATION

NOTE:

q

q

1. Remove the battery compartment cover gently.
2. Install 8 x 'C' size batteries (UM-2 or equivalent) taking care that the correct polarities

are observed.

3. Replace the battery compartment cover.

The AC line cord must be removed for battery operation.
To avoid damage which may result from leaking batteries, remove the batteries
when they become weak or when the unit is not to be used for long period of time.

Insert one end of the AC power cord to the socket located at the rear of the player, and
the other end to the wall outlet.

Please be sure the AC Voltage Selector is switched to your local voltage (for

dual voltage version) (optional).
